Inspiring Conversations with Meg Sharp of Sharp Studios

Today we’d like to introduce you to Meg Sharp.

Alright, so thank you so much for sharing your story and insight with our readers. To kick things off, can you tell us a bit about how you got started?
I am a third-generation family business owner at Sharp & Associates, founded over 60 years ago by my grandfather, Dennis Sharp. I’ve been working there for about 10 years now alongside my grandfather, my mom and our amazing team of employees that have been with us longer than I can remember.

We deal in Commercial Leasing, General Contracting, Self-storage and vacation rentals, which are all seemingly different industries, but at the root of it, we basically specialize in Rental Space. We build it, we own it, and we rent it out.

Keeping that in mind, this past year I was looking to add a little more creativity to my life and shake up the day-to-day rental business. I really wanted to find something that would cater to my passion for creating, party planning and designing. That’s when a good friend of mine, Skylar Rae Olson, owner of Photography by Skylar Rae, turned me onto the idea of photography studios. After thinking it over I realized the creative possibilities in a photography studio would be endless, and it’s right up my alley with my background in rental space. So, I got to work!

My team and I, along with our trusty studio dog Mic, spent last summer renovating a vacant warehouse in Ramsey into a modern industrial, natural light rental studio for photography and events. We officially opened the doors to Sharp Studios in October of 2021 and it’s been so amazing to watch this business grow in such a short amount of time, and I can’t wait to see where it goes in the future.

Can you talk to us a bit about the challenges and lessons you’ve learned along the way. Looking back would you say it’s been easy or smooth in retrospect?
When we first sat down and talked about opening a photography studio in one of our commercial properties it was a pretty quick and easy conversation. With our general contracting division, we do commercial build outs frequently and we can get projects like this done in no time – “We’ll use this space, add a wall here, improve the lighting here and boom, it’s done”.

The only real obstacle we ran into during the building process was the material shortage that was going on around this time last year. It made us push the grand opening by a few months, but other than that we were still able to get the studio up and running in a timely manner.

Since opening, we’ve run into a few obstacles making sure the space really caters to photographers, which has been a learning experience in itself being we’re not actually photographers, and we didn’t know a lot about their specific wants and needs going into this. Because of this, we’ve relied heavily on feedback from our clients to make sure we’re giving them a space that has ample lighting, the right aesthetic, things of that nature.

After the first 5 months in business, we had a ton of positive feedback on the space, but we knew there were a few things we could improve to really ‘wow’ our clients and keep them coming back. So, we ended up doing a total makeover, adding white floors, a bright and airy seating area, updating our glamour station and more, and from what we’ve heard, it really took our studio to the next level.

As you know, we’re big fans of Sharp Studios. For our readers who might not be as familiar what can you tell them about the brand?
Sharp Studios is a natural light photography studio located in Ramsey, MN offering 1500 square feet of commercial warehouse space that’s been reimagined into a modern, bright and airy photography studio. We’re available to rent any day of the week for quick 2-hour sessions, half day sessions or full day sessions depending on what your needs are, and we also entertain small events if you are looking for a space to host bridal showers, networking events, etc.

We’re known for the incredible natural light that flows in from our floor-to-ceiling windows, and our newly designed bright + white studio space that creates trendy, yet timeless, backdrops for our client’s special moments. We also offer a variety of movable wall backdrops, props and furniture so clients can really customize their photoshoots and create a look that fits any session whether it’s newborns, families, branding or even pets! We love a good pet session, and you can catch our studio dog, Mic, all over our social media pages helping us with test shoots and more!

Another thing that we think really sets us apart from other photography studios in Minnesota is our location. We like to call ourselves the ‘premier suburban studio’ because, unlike most photography studios, we’re not located in the heart of a busy city. We are conveniently located near the suburbs of Ramsey, right off Highway 10, which makes it almost effortless for clients to get in and out without having to deal with the limited parking and heavy traffic issues that come with booking spaces in the cities.

Not to mention the network of creatives just north of the city is absolutely incredible! We have so many amazing clients that come from just a few miles away and absolutely love the idea of not having to go far to get quality studio photos.
